The yellow Chevrolet Camaro with black stripes down the middle has been known as Bumblebee, a main character in the Transformers series, since the release of the first movie in 2007. Rather than transforming into a massive robot, this 2010 muscle car has changed junior Justin Arle’s experience as a teenage driver.
“Most people wouldn’t think that a 16-year-old would own this car,” Arle said, “I’ve always wanted a Camaro. It was really exciting when I bought it.
The car’s ties to the film’s franchise were not his only motivation for purchasing it, however. With a top speed that exceeds 160 mph and a v6 engine that has 304 horsepower, it is easy for his friends to describe it as being fast, cool, and powerful.
